Quarterly Planning Note — Support Outsourcing

Quick heads-up for finance: we're moving ahead with outsourcing tier-one customer support to the Pellam Desk group starting next quarter. Expect transition costs of about 40k up front, then roughly 18% savings on run-rate by spring. Keep the current team's budget intact until cutover is confirmed. The reasoning behind the timing sits in the confidential note below.

management briefing: Project Ulavan slips by two quarters because of the staffing delay.

# Bounce Processor Constants
#
# The Mailhenge bounce processor classifies inbound bounce reports from the
# Dunmore relay into hard and soft categories, then updates suppression
# lists accordingly. Soft bounces are retried with exponential backoff;
# hard bounces suppress immediately. These constants control retry depth,
# backoff growth, and the suppression threshold. Changing them affects
# deliverability reputation, so any edit needs sign-off before a release
# branch is cut. The module reads the values defined directly below.

tuning table, kajog-kawef:
PRIORITIES = {
    "kelox": 870,
    "kasix": 89,
    "eliax": 988,
}

When a content editor publishes a change, our build orchestrator, Rebuildr, computes a dependency graph and regenerates only the affected pages rather than the entire site. This keeps publish times under a minute for most edits. Be aware that template changes invalidate the whole graph and trigger a full rebuild, which can take up to twenty minutes. If you see unexpectedly long builds, inspect the invalidation log first. Detailed architecture notes and troubleshooting steps live on the internal wiki page.

runbook for badug-kadup: https://confluence.zemvarlabs.internal/projects/browse/display/projects/bd1b

### Step 4: Switch bounce processing to Larkspool

After merging the adapter from Step 3, redirect the bounce processor to the new Larkspool queue. The legacy Mailwright poller should be left running in shadow mode for one release cycle so discrepancies surface in the comparison report. Reviewers should confirm that retry counts and suppression-list writes match between both paths before approving. Once verified, apply the processor settings listed directly below.

service settings:
PRAIX_LOG_LEVEL=error
PRAIX_METRICS_HOST=metrics.praix.qorvelcorp.corp
PRAIX_POOL_SIZE=16